Stefano Pioli has officially left his role as Al-Nassr manager ahead of an imminent return to the Serie A with Fiorentina.

After a lackluster season, Pioli took over as Al-Nassr’s head coach in September of last year, succeeding Luis Castro.

Despite placing third in the Saudi Pro League and losing in the Kings Cup and AFC Champions League, the former AC Milan manager did not win any trophy with the Saudi club during the 2024–25 season.

According to Goal, after his stint in the Middle East, Pioli is anticipated to return to Italy, where he will be awaiting his Fiorentina position.

Meanwhile, Al-Nassr have to hire a new gaffer, and former Ronaldo teammate Sergio Conceicao has been linked to a transfer to Al-Awwal Park.

statement from Al-Nassr reads: “Al Nassr Club Company informs that Mr Pioli and his Staff are no more the acting coaching staff of the first team.

“We would like to thank Mr Pioli and his staff for their dedicated work during the past season.”

As the 2025–26 Saudi Pro League season begins in August, Ronaldo will soon be working with his fifth manager in two and a half years at the club.
